    What does it mean to be the Global Head of Capital Markets? We have Janel Jackson and Anita Rausch here to tell us.
    Anita Rausch is a Senior Vice President and Global Head of ETF Capital Markets, managing the liquidity and trading education of AB’s suite of exchange-traded funds (ETFs). Before joining the firm in 2022, she was head of Capital Markets for WisdomTree, a global ETF-only asset manager. She holds a BA in international business, with a minor in German, from the George Washington University. Anita is married with 2 kids (8 years and 12 years) and resides in Bergen County, NJ.  She regularly enjoys time with the family skiing in the winter, and driving fast cars in the summer.  
     
    Janel Jackson is the Global Head of ETF Capital Markets at Vanguard. Janel joined Vanguard in 2012 as part of the company’s M.B.A. Leadership Development Program. She has also served as chief of staff to Vanguard’s chief investment officer and as senior investment analyst in Vanguard Institutional Advisory Services®.  Janel earned a B.A. from Ohio University and an M.B.A. from the Georgia Institute of Technology. She holds FINRA Series 7 and 66 licenses and is a member of the U.S. board of directors for Women in ETFs. Janel enjoys spending time with her family. She is also a foodie with a love for traveling to warm vacation spots. 
    Kristine Delano guides the conversation about using your knowledge to become invaluable and the different skill sets necessary to navigate within the world of ETF Capital Markets.

    Head of Research

    Head of Research

    Today, we are speaking to leaders who can both geek out on data and translate the big picture of our economy. They are the Head of Research. From strategic planning to market analysis to industry trends, how do their roles guide the creation and management of ETFs? 
    We have Matt Dines and Carol Spain with us today. 
    Carol Spain is a Managing Director and Head of Credit Research for Schwab Asset Management. Carol earned a Master of Public Policy from the University of Chicago and a Bachelor of Arts in political science from the University of Notre Dame. She is an active member of the National Federation of Municipal Analysts and is a member of the External Advisory Panel of the Government Finance Research Center. Carol lives in Chicago with her husband and two small children. 
     
    Matt Dines serves as Chief Investment Officer at Build Asset Management, where he oversees portfolio management, capital allocation, and strategy for the firm and its clients. Matt holds a Master’s degree in Finance from Washington University in St. Louis, with a focus on Quantitative Finance. He holds a Bachelor’s degree in Biological Science from the University of Notre Dame. Matt earned his Chartered Financial Analyst® designation in 2017. Matt and his wife live in Seattle with their twin boys.  
    Kristine Delano guides the conversation about the hard work and skills it takes to research and analyze data in the world of ETFs.

    Compliance

    Compliance

    Compliance professionals play a vital role in maintaining the integrity and transparency of the ETF industry. Now, that may sound a bit dry, but I assure you, throughout my career, compliance departments have been filled with some of the most dynamic and interesting professionals at the firm. Today, we are joined by Amy Shelton and Melanie Zimdars.
    Amy Shelton is Senior Vice President and Chief Compliance Officer (CCO) for the American Century Funds, Advisor, Broker-Dealer and global operations. Amy is a member of key oversight committees including the Investment Oversight Committee and the Products & Markets Committee. Amy joined American Century Investments in 1994 and has served as CCO since 2014. In her free time, Amy enjoys cooking and hosting paella parties with her husband. 
    Melanie Zimdars is Chief Compliance Officer (CCO) of Invesco Capital Management LLC. Prior to joining Invesco, Melanie served as Vice President and deputy Chief Compliance Officer at ALPS Holding, Inc. from 2009 to 2017. Melanie enjoys spending time outdoors with her husband and son, hiking and snowshoeing. 
    Kristine Delano guides the conversation about fostering team relationships and building strong communication skills in the fast paced world ETF Compliance.

    Analyst

    Analyst

    Today we are diving into the bones of Exchange-Traded Funds. Without them we’d have no form and nothing to offer investors. Who are these essential minds? ETF Analysts are scientists, detectives, and reporters all rolled up into the span of a single trading session. We have two fantastic guests to give us a peek at what they do. Anu Ganti and Rachel Liang are joining us for today’s episode.
    Anu R. Ganti is Senior Director, Index Investment Strategy at S&P Dow Jones Indices. She is also a frequent contributor to both print and broadcast media outlets. Prior to joining S&P DJI, Anu worked in the asset management space, completing a post-MBA rotational program at Russell Investments within their fixed income research and trading divisions and working as a portfolio manager focusing on emerging market equities at Parametric Portfolio Associates (subsidiary of Eaton Vance). Anu is a CFA charterholder and holds an MBA in finance and economics from Columbia Business School, and a bachelor’s degree in finance and marketing from NYU’s Stern School of Business. She is married and lives with her husband in suburban New Jersey.
    Rachel Liang is an experienced ETF Capital Market Research Analyst with a deep background in quantitative and data analytics field. Born and raised in northern China, she relocated to the U.S. in 2012. Rachel holds a bachelor's degree of Applied Mathematics in Beijing Institute of Technology, and a master’s degree of Financial Mathematics from Rutgers in New Jersey. She currently lives and works in New York City. Outside of work, Rachel loves Jazz music, reading, and baking in winter times. She holds Series 7 and 63, and is a CFA charterholder. 
    Kristine Delano guides the conversation about how curiosity, creativity, and communication all play vital roles for Analysts as they navigate the evolving industry of ETFs.
